Coating Technologies for Large-Scale Production
Choosing the right technology is essential for achieving uniform and durable results. The main methods include:
1. Spray Coating
-
Method: Uses spray guns to apply the coating evenly.
-
Advantages: High precision, ideal for complex surfaces.
-
Applications: Automotive, furniture, appliances.
2. UV Coating
-
Method: Uses ultraviolet light to quickly polymerize the coating.
-
Advantages: Ultra-fast drying, reduced environmental impact.
-
Applications: Electronics, luxury packaging.
How to Optimize Customized Coating in Production
To maximize the benefits of customized coating, it is important to follow best practices:
1. Material and Coating Selection
-
Use coatings with high chemical and mechanical resistance.
-
Prefer eco-friendly, low-impact solutions.
2. Automation and Robotics
-
Invest in automated systems to ensure uniformity and reduce waste.
-
Use robots for complex and high-precision processes.
3. Quality Control
-
Implement adhesion and durability tests.
-
Verify compliance with industry standards.
4. Large-Scale Customization
-
Offer a wide range of colors and special finishes.
-
Use technologies like hydrographics for innovative 3D effects.
